Key Facts
- Jenny Stauber's place of birth was Sydney[2].
- Jenny Stauber was born on +1958-05-17T00:00:00Z[3].
- Jenny Stauber held citizenship in Australia[6].
- Jenny Stauber worked as a toxicologist[4].
- Among Jenny Stauber's employers was Commonwealth Scientific and Industrial Research Organisation[7].
- Jenny Stauber's education included a stint at University of Sydney[8].
- Jenny Stauber was educated at University of Sydney[9].
- Jenny Stauber was educated at University of Tasmania[10].
- Jenny Stauber received the Fellow of the Australian Academy of Science[11].
- Jenny Stauber received the CSIRO Medal for Lifetime Achievement[12].
- Jenny Stauber received the Fellow of the Australian Academy of Technology and Engineering[13].
- Jenny Stauber is recorded as female[14].
